ABSTRACT
Abstract The radiation damage characteristics of three types of plastic scintillators, BC-408, EJ-200 and BC-404, are experimentally studied. The results show that after irradiation, the light yield and light transmission of these scintillators decrease and the shapes of the excitation and emission spectra remain unchanged. Recovery of light yield is not observed after weak irradiation.
